They called it a strike-slip type of quake:
Two geological blocks were grinding against each other, side-by-side, as one moves (roughly speaking) horizontally in the opposite direction to the other.
That type of activity does release electro-kinetic energy that radiates upwards (and all around the contact locations. It is conjectured that sensitive people can pick this up as well as animals with their feet on the ground (feeling the electric charges or sensations).

the quake took place on a shallow strike slip fault within the North American plate, one that was very steeply inclined.
The area is known for its high seismic hazard, so earthquakes like this are to be expected from time to time; over the past 40 years, there have been eight other earthquakes fairly close to the July 4 tremblor near Ridgecrest coming in at a magnitude 5-or-above.
